How to Choose Large Dog Coats

Large dog coats should provide insulation without restricting movement. Focus on materials and features that suit your climate and your dog's outdoor habits.

Material and Insulation

Choose thicker insulation for harsh winters, but lighter layers may work for milder weather or active dogs.

Fit and Adjustability

A snug but non-restrictive fit helps keep the coat in place and prevents chafing during walks or play.

Ease of Use

If your dog dislikes getting dressed, look for simple closures and minimal steps to put the coat on.

Visibility and Safety

Safety features are especially important for dogs who walk near roads or in busy areas.

Activity Level and Durability

Match the coat’s durability to your dog's typical activities—working breeds or outdoor enthusiasts may need tougher fabrics.

FAQ For Large Dog Coats

1. How do I measure my large dog for a winter coat?

Measure your dog's chest girth, back length from neck to tail base, and neck circumference. Use these measurements to compare with sizing charts, as proper fit is essential for comfort and warmth.

2. What materials are best for large dog coats in winter?

Fleece and insulated polyester provide warmth, while waterproof or water-resistant shells help keep your dog dry. Canvas and heavy-duty fabrics are ideal for durability in rough conditions.

3. Are built-in harnesses on dog coats safe and practical?

Built-in harnesses can be convenient and secure, reducing the need for extra gear. Ensure the harness is sturdy and properly positioned for your dog's size and walking style.

4. How can I keep my dog visible during evening walks in winter?

Look for coats with reflective strips or piping, and consider bright colors that stand out in low-light conditions. Visibility features help keep your dog safer near traffic or in dim environments.

5. Can large dog coats be washed in a machine?

Many dog coats are machine-washable for easy cleaning. Always check the care instructions to maintain the coat’s shape and function.
